Vintage Japanese Signed Chisel Slick Laminated Forged Iron 24mm Nomi Red Oak Tansu This exceptional Japanese nomi (chisel)Vintage Japanese nomi are truly impressive in the quality of their steel. This exceptional Japanese nomi (chisel) was made many decades ago in the mid 20th century by a master Japanese blade maker in the tradition of the samurai sword, with high carbon laminated steel that holds an edge like no other in the world.
